Fade to Black | |
---|---|
Domestic Release Date | Nov 5, 2004 |
Production Budget | |
Opening Weekend Theaters | 170 |
Maximum Theaters | 170 |
Theatrical Engagements | 337 |
Domestic Opening Weekend | $449,331 |
Domestic Box Office | $728,802 |
Inflation Adjusted Domestic Box Office |
$1,265,130 |
International Box Office | |
Worldwide Box Office | $728,802 |

Note: A theatrical engagement is defined as the movie playing in a single theater for one week. So, for example, a film that plays in 3,000 theaters in its first week and 2,000 theaters in its second week will have had 5,000 theatrical engagements.
